Web20 feb. 2024 · Kirchhoff’s second rule (the loop rule) is an application of conservation of energy. The loop rule is stated in terms of potential, rather than potential energy, but the two are related since PEelec = qV. Recall that emf is the potential difference of a source when no current is flowing.

THEOREM 2. how to say hello in indigenousKirchhoff's theorem can be generalized to count k-component spanning forests in an unweighted graph. A k -component spanning forest is a subgraph with k connected components that contains all vertices and is cycle-free, i.e., there is at most one path between each pair of vertices.
